Girl Scouts of Southwest Texas (GSSWT) remains committed to keeping members of our council safe and healthy. GSSWT is following levels of COVID-19 prevention protocols based on the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ention’s (CDC) tracking of COVID-19 Community Levels of risk.

Please note: These protocols will vary based on a member’s county of residence/the county in which a Girl Scout activity is taking place. If there is a difference between the two, prevention protocols will be based on the county with the highest level of risk.

Regardless of a county’s community level of risk, all Girl Scouts and volunteers are always encouraged to practice good hand hygiene, minimize the use of shared materials, and take precautions when eating snacks or meals.
